FAILURES OF LOCAL SCHOOL BOARDS IN PERFORMING THEIR ROLES AS SOCIETY’S REPRESENTATIVE IN CONTROLLING PUBLIC SCHOOLS IN WAITING FOR SUPERMAN FILM

United States of America, which is recognized as a powerful country puts a great concern toward education. This can be seen from the way government provides free public education for its citizens. Yet, the quality is questionable. The Board of Education is the council responsible for providing good education; it is also responding to community wishes for educational betterment. In its leadership, problems appear and lead to failing public schools. This eventually brings failures to students. Such existing situation in American public schools can be seen through literary works, film is one in case. Waiting for Superman is one showing it.
